Just be careful when you're getting a "great deal" on suede. My understanding is that a lot of the more affordable stuff doesn't have the same UV resistance as the more expensive "alcentara", and will fade badly very quickly.

Thanks....I kindof surprised myself too.

those two pieces only took about one hour total but thats the problem....I was distracted and rushed so I 'm gonna redo the handle part. The material doesn't really stretch you just have to work it alittle bit at a time till you get it right. The best thing is to try to fit the material and see how your gonna make it fit BEFORE you spray it with adhesive
